ADULT STICK & PUCK
Rink is open to adults who wish to skate with a hockey stick
and /or shoot pucks. Protective gear is optional. $5 Adults $3 Seniors
* Monday, Tuesday, Thursday & Friday . . . . . . . . . . . . . .11:30 am – 12:50 pm
DROP-IN HOCKEY
Rink is open to hockey players for pick-up games, practice,
etc. Full protective gear required. Times may be age specific. $10 Adults $5 Children

Learn to Skate
US Figure Skating Association CURRICULUM
Snowplow Sam 1 (Ages 3 – 5) | No experience is required. First time on skates. This class familiarizes skaters with skates, ice, balance and moving on the ice. |
---|---|
Snowplow Sam 2 & 3 (Ages 3 – 5) | Skaters with minimal experience. Marching, forward skating, two foot hops, gliding and snowplow stops. |
Basic 1 & Hockey 1 | Skaters with minimal experience. Marching, forward skating, two foot hops, gliding and snowplow stops. |
Basic 2 & Hockey 2 | Must have passed Basic 1 or Hockey 1. One foot glides, backward skating, backward swizzles, two foot turns. |
Basic 3 | Must have passed Basic 2. Forward stroking, forward and backward pumping on circle, backward one footglides, two foot spins. |
Basic 4 | Must have passed Basic 3. Forward inside and outside edges, forward crossovers, outside three-turns, backward snowplow stops. |
Basic 5 - 8 | Must have passed Basic 4. Skaters will learn more advanced edges and turns, backward crossovers, beginning jumps and spins. |
